How are batteries reprocessed?

It bothers alkaline/ salt batteries, Lithium batteries, Ni-Cd batteries, Li-ion batteries, NiMH batteries. The batteries or accumulators are presented into a melting furnace. The break up of the metals is performed by an oxidation-reduction reaction. Is it dangerous to store batteries in your house?


 

Today, there is no harm in storing batteries at home, because batteries (90% of batteries marketed) no longer contain metals including lead, mercury or cadmium for two decades.
